Winter
She’s here, crept in ever so softly that we didn’t even feel her presence until a couple of days ago and even now the sun shines bright in the afternoon.
It set me thinking – what does winter mean to you?
To me it means – grey misty mornings when we get up before the sun does, and watch it give way to the moon and the stars way too early.
It means - lots of peanuts, boiled, fried or roasted
It means warm socks and popcorn
It means – my favorite gajak (a sweet made of jaggery and sesame seed)
It means – snuggling in an enormous razai (quilt)
It means tucking in two shivery dogs to bed.
It means – airing musty smelling woolies.
It means lunch on the sun warmed lawn.
It means – homemade soup.
It means – lots of baking for Christmas.
It means - the stereo will be singing its head off Christmassy music.
It means – a postman weighed down by a load of cards and letters.
It means – rehearsals for Christmas plays.
It means a late night party of chocolate and marshmallows with friends
It means - barbeque on the roof (ours is flat)
It means – pictures of snow on the calendar.
It means – lots of coffee and wassail to drink.
It means – freezing motor bike rides.
It means – off with fans and coolers and on with the heaters.
It means – steaming hot water baths.
It means – staying awake to greet the New Year.
It means – clothes that take long to dry.
It means – that my sister's birthday is drawing nigh (not that she lets us forget)
It means – early morning foggy breath.
It means – snoozing in the sun.
It means – being swathed in warm cozy shawls.
It means – apples and oranges and chickoos and custard apples and dates and sweet limes, all winter fruit here.

Just a musing that came over me! Thought I’d share it with you
